N2 - We derive a new factorization relation for the semileptonic radiative decay B→π νγ in the kinematical region of a slow pion |p→π|∼Λ and an energetic photon Eγ Λ, working at leading order in Λ/mb. In the limit of a soft pion, the nonperturbative matrix element appearing in this relation can be computed using chiral perturbation theory. We present a phenomenological study of this decay, which may be important for a precise determination of the exclusive nonradiative decay.
